The crowds observed with attentive eyes as the Ancient Divinity trailed along the Temple’s Platform.
The adorable creature appeared like it was having the best time of its life. It strolled in circles seemingly enticed by the present crowd, giggling and posing pompously. As for Jack, it had completely ignored him, as if he wasn’t worthy of its attention.
Distracted by the Ancient Divinity's weird behaviour, nobody had noticed that Jack’s face had long lost its colour.
He knew that sometimes, when one sowed karma, it may have to be reaped. But the scene playing before his eyes seemed like a cruel prank from the heavens!
His entire body was trembling, wanting to shed tears of blood. He was finding it hard to accept how a stupid creature, the same creature he had quarrelled against in the forest, would have such an important identity!
Just when he thought he had finally found some peace, the entire earth had become an abyss, and the heavens crumbled!
After wandering about for a long time, the Ancient Divinity finally rested its gaze at the still shivering Jack. Its eyes glittered, and a mocking expression was visible on its face.
Jack instantly understood that if the creature could talk, he would be receiving a barrage of insults right now.
Elder Tian noticed that something was amiss and was about to express something, but the Ancient Divinity had already sprung into action.
It turned around, giving its back to the crowds and revealing its furry tail. The tail shuddered, then it slowly expanded… 1 metre… 1.25 metres… 1.5 metres…. until finally stopping at 2 metres.
When the crowds noted the length of the tail, they were clearly left disappointed.
“So much for drama… it’s the two-metre tail…”
“Well, did you really expect otherwise?”
After having observed the strange behaviour of the Ancient Divinity, all of them had thought that something unusual was about to happen. But once they saw the tail growing to a full two-metre before stopping, their hopes quickly faded away.
Meanwhile, Elder Tian felt relieved as he nodded towards Jack. “Congratulations, from today you are officially a disciple of the Sky Water Sect.”
However, his joy was not shared by Jack.
Instead, Jack had a sense of growing uneasiness. He thought that unless the creature before him had the memory of a goldfish, there was no way he was going to get out of this situation unscathed. No, after observing the creature’s behaviour earlier, he was already preparing himself for the worst.
And he had guessed correctly.
The Ancient Divinity, like a predator playing with its prey, was just waiting for the perfect moment to strike. Suddenly, its tail shivered, and in a couple of breaths, it expanded to three metres!
When everyone noticed the sudden expansion of the tail, a huge commotion erupted. Even Elder Tian felt flabbergasted, unwilling to believe what his eyes were seeing.
Loud voices competed with each other as the various disciples discussed the possible meaning of this length. They were only used in seeing the two-metre tail; they never had the opportunity to experience the different lengths before!
After a brief moment of discussions, an old woman with freckles appeared. She flipped through a dusty looking manual, then yelled with a loud voice, “According to the sect’s manual, the three-metre tail signifies rejection!”
But her words had yet to reach the ears of the disciples when the Ancient Divinity’s tail began enlarging again, and in a short number of breaths, it was now four metres erect!
This sudden development naturally shocked the crowds even more. Everyone stared at each other dumbfounded. Not even in their wildest dreams would they have anticipated this unexpected turn of events; what was supposed to be a boring admission of a useless cultivator, actually turn out to be so exciting! And this was not just any recommendation by the way, but a recommendation by one of the Sect Elders!
Advertisement
Suddenly perceiving an overwhelming amount of glances on herself, the old woman rubbed her nose and straightened her back. She seemed to struggle with the sudden expectations from the crowd. She cleared her throat before shouting. “Jail punishment! The four-metre tail, signifies Jail punishment!”
The various disciples seemed to be having a blast as they immersed themselves, discussing the implications of the different lengths. Unlike Jack, who was biting his lips and gazing at the creature with murderous eyes.
“Aren’t you taking it a bit too far now?”
The creature arrogantly ignored him. This was its moment to enjoy. It knew that it had the upper hand here, and revenge was surely guaranteed. From its perspective, Jack was not in a position to do anything. Right now, it was the king, and Jack was a disposable pawn.
Instead, it let out a low pitched moan, and a red strain appeared on its face as if the tail’s extension required a lot of physical effort. However, knowing that it was the centre of attention, it seemed to regain its composure.
It cried a miserable shriek as its tail began shivering again, extending to five metres!
“Incredible! It enlarged again!”
“I can’t believe it! Five metres!”
“What grave immoralities has this man done to trigger such a heavenly condemnation?!”
The yelling of the crowd began attracting nearby cultivators. Piqued by their curiosities, soon more and more cultivators of different ages arrived. In a short amount of breaths, the entire piazza surrounding the temple was fully occupied.
One of these new arrivals was a notable man wearing an azure robe. He was surrounded by a noble aura, his face as white as the light of the moon. His facial hair was also white, but his eyes were as sharp as a wolf’s and his back as solid as a tiger’s.
He floated towards the middle, then elegantly descended next to Elder Tian.
When the disciples noticed him, they all bowed respectfully. Not a single one of them dared to act recklessly before the third most powerful expert of the sect.
Because this man was none other than one of the two sect’s elders, Sect Elder Shui!
“What’s this ruckus?” Unlike his counterpart, he didn’t hesitate to use power in his voice as a form of intimidation.
His enquiring eyes extended towards Elder Tian, then passed over Jack until finally resting fixed over the Ancient Divinity.
“The five-metre tail… death penalty…” He said, his voice calm yet radiating killing intent.
Jack remained motionless, unwilling to believe this absurdity.
He was a man who had survived for years inside a slave market, he had survived a crazy supernatural human who could stir the heavens and crack the lands, he also had managed to outlive the encounter with that black creature and that grotesque face… but now he was going to perish because he ate a fruit?
But no matter how much he thought, he couldn’t think of a way out of this mess. He was just too powerless against these monsters. The only thing he could do was cursing at himself for starting a fight with that creature. If he knew it would end up like this, he would have definitely let it obtain that fruit back then!
Elder Tian was the first to break the silence. “Elder Shui… don’t tell me you are considering to harm–
“Nonsense!” Elder Shui quickly rebuked him, his authoritative voice thundering into everyone ears. “You are a sect elder, and you dare to even propose something so outrageous?! So what if he is a mortal?! The Ancient Divinity is the direct descendant of our Ancestral Divinity! It is also the Patriarch's personal wish that the Ancient Divinity filters new candidates! Don’t tell me you want to act against both the wills of the Ancestral Divinity and the Patriarch?!”
Advertisement
After hearing Elder Shui’s words, Elder Tian lowered his head and fell into complete silence. His face was full of gloom as he glanced towards Jack with a sense of guilt.
Jack frowned. If he had to die, then he definitely had to bring that creature down with him. Only by doing so he would die without regrets. Otherwise, his soul would surely never find peace for all eternity.
On the other hand, even though the Ancient Divinity was dying from pain and its face was now redder than blood, it appeared more ecstatic than before.
It was at this moment that both Elders seemed to have noticed something. Both of them had thought of the same idea, but unfortunately for Elder Tian, Elder Shui had a faster reaction.
“Hmm?! How could I have forgotten about that important matter? Am I becoming too old?” This sudden change of conduct by Elder Shui confused everyone present.
“Elder Tian, unfortunately, I have to leave this trial in your good hands.”
He flipped his robe and flew away, his speed quickly accelerating.
All sect disciples appeared puzzled as they watched Elder Shui’s silhouette fade away. They wanted to ask questions, but any doubts they had were immediately repelled when they heard a familiar voice.
“Aw man. All of you are here having fun, and nobody bothered to invite me? Simply unforgivable!”
A young man could be heard approaching the area. He wore a colourful robe, much more vibrant than those of the other disciples. His hands were clasped behind his back, his expression totally unreadable. Fixed over his head was a small medicinal plant, giving him an odd appearance.
Everyone but Jack instantly recognised him. He was one of the seven junior elders, the infamous Dai Jun!
The various disciples all glanced towards Dai Jun with different expressions. Some glanced at him weirdly, others with disgust, while the majority seemed to fear him. Regardless of their reaction, everyone appeared to be spreading out, keeping a safe distance from him.
Dai Jun turned to look at the direction at which Elder Shui left, but seeing that he had already fled, he snorted. Instead, he kept walking towards the entrance of the temple.
Hearing the approaching footsteps, the Ancient Divinity shivered, slowly retracting its tail. At this instant, it had entirely forgotten about Jack.
Dai Jun inspected the crowd. “So? What’s going on? Where is the fun?”
He waited for a response. However, nobody dared to reply. “Geez… What a boring sect I’ve found myself mingled with…”
Dai Jun kept walking ahead until arriving in front of the Ancient Divinity, only a short distance away.
The creature’s fur spiked upwards, revealing its threatening teeth. However, it didn’t dare to make a move but instead took a couple of steps in reverse.
“You know, if it weren’t for you being the descendant of the Original Ancestor, I would have already had the pleasure of tasting that meat of yours. I can’t believe the sect’s Patriarchs never noticed what a boring and useless creature you are.”
Upon hearing these words, the Creature shivered in terror as it hurried its retreating steps. It let out a squeak of defeat, then ran back inside the temple.
Dai Jun then turned around and moved towards the blinking Jack. “Seems like that pile of crappy fur hates you. Anyone it hates, is inevitably my friend.”
He summoned a medallion and a bottle of medicinal pills, which he casually threw towards Jack. As soon as Jack grabbed the medallion, it started glittering with strange colourful lights that circulated it, giving it an ethereal feeling.
When the various disciples noticed the medallion, shivers ran down their spines, and their hearts skipped a couple of beats. That is because every one of them understood the real significance of that special medallion!
Dai Jun coolly said, “I’m using my privileges to promote you to an inner sect disciple. Until you unlock your cultivation, you should take one of those pills per day. It will keep you alive without the need to eat…”
These words left Dai Jun mouth in an unimpressive manner, yet they were enough to silence everyone present. It felt like a cold wind had descended from the underworld and froze the entire area with chilling ice. Even Elder Tian was left speechless.
“Inner Sect Disciple?” Jack, who was still recovering from his earlier crisis innocently asked.
Not only Jack, everyone present in the piazza was asking the same question.
An inner sect disciple? They knew the implications of those words very well!
Only a genius who had worked hard his entire life or those born with rich bloodlines had a chance to obtain the inner disciple status, and that was still not a guarantee for success! After all, the number of inner disciples in the sect could be counted with one’s hands!
And yet, this guy appeared out of nowhere and received this position! Not only that, but apparently this good for nothing who just a moment ago had one foot in the grave had yet to unlock his cultivation base! He was a useless piece of junk!
Many of these were proud cultivators who had experienced a lot of hardships, and had long given up on their dreams of becoming an inner sect disciple! But today, this complete stranger was promoted to an inner sect disciple! How could they not feel humiliated? This entire affair was a massive blow to their dignities!
Many of them started loathing Dai Jun and Jack with sharp and maddening eyes.
Dai Jun noticed this and nonchalantly asked. “What? Someone has an objection?!”
However, none of the disciples replied back.
It was then that Jack fell on his knees and kowtowed in appreciation. “Thanks for saving this lowly one’s life!”
Dai Jun glanced at him and snorted. “Enough with the formalities. Follow after me.”
The stunned disciples and Elder Tian watched as Dai Jun walked away with Jack. However, Dai Jun suddenly paused for a moment.
“Elder Tian, you still haven’t paid me for those pink pills.” Then he kept walking.
When he heard this, Elder Tian’s mouth fell to the floor as the entire piazza focused its attention on him.
Elder Tian coughed a few times. “Don’t worry Dai Jun… cough cough I will have the sum delivered in the coming days.”
His face now redder than red bayberry, he turned to address the gossiping crowds. “What are you thinking? The pink pills are just… cough cough medicinal pills for improving… my ageing skin…”
The disciples nodded in agreement, seemingly accepting his explanation. However, Elder Tian could sense that deep down they didn’t believe him.
He lost his composure for the first time and flew away in shame.
